THE MENU script

Margot and Tyler travel to Hawthorn, an exclusive island restaurant, where Chef Slowik has prepared a special tasting menu for a select group of guests. As the evening progresses, Slowik's courses become increasingly disturbing, revealing his contempt for the wealthy elite and the culinary industry, leading to a staff member's suicide and a violent attack on the Chef. Margot, an escort hired by Tyler, discovers Slowik's personal cottage and a hidden room where she finds a radio and contacts the Coast Guard. Upon returning to the dining room, Margot challenges Slowik to make her a cheeseburger, which she eats while escaping on a Coast Guard boat as the restaurant and everyone inside are consumed by fire in Slowik's final, deadly culinary performance.

Writer
Seth Reiss & Will Tracy
